.ccm-toolbar-visible div.ccm-page header,.ccm-toolbar-visible div.ccm-page footer,.ccm-toolbar-visible #logo-container{visibility: hidden !important}body,body.pushable,body.pushable > .pusher{background-color: #000 !important;color: #000}div.ccm-page{color: #FFF}div.ccm-page header,div.ccm-page footer{position: fixed;height: 25%;display: block;width: 100%;z-index: 110;text-align: center;color: #f2f2f2;padding: 20px 0 0 0;z-index: 110 !important}div.ccm-page header{min-height: 210px}div.ccm-page header{top: 0;background-position: right bottom;background-repeat: no-repeat}div.ccm-page footer{bottom: 0;z-index: 50 !important;background-position: left top;background-repeat: no-repeat}div.ccm-page .animation1 h1{position: absolute;top: -100px;left: -100px;font-size: 4em;font-family: arial, helvetica;color: #ffffff !important;margin: 0;padding: 0;text-shadow: 4px 4px 12px #000;text-align: center;z-index: 999;opacity: 0;text-transform: uppercase}div.ccm-page div.ccm-block-edit h1{visibility: visible !important}div.ccm-page .redactor-editor{background-color: #000}div.ccm-page .section{overflow: hidden;background-repeat: no-repeat;background-size: cover !important;background-position: center}div.ccm-page .section-edit{min-height: 300px}div.ccm-page #section0 .layer{position: absolute;z-index: 4;width: 100%;left: 0;top: 43%}div.ccm-page #section0{overflow: hidden}div.ccm-page .fullscreen-bg{position: absolute;right: 0;bottom: 0;top: 0;width: 100%;height: 100%;background-size: 100% 100%;background-color: black;background-position: center center;object-fit: cover;z-index: 3}div.ccm-page .fp-section video{position: absolute;top: 50%;left: 50%;width: auto;height: auto;min-width: 100%;min-height: 100%;-webkit-transform: translate(-50%, -50%);-moz-transform: translate(-50%, -50%);-ms-transform: translate(-50%, -50%);transform: translate(-50%, -50%);z-index: 3}div.ccm-page .ui.inverted.segment,div.ccm-page .ui.primary.inverted.segment{background: rgba(27,28,29,0.65) none repeat scroll 0 0;color: rgba(255,255,255,0.9)}div.ccm-page .ui.tabular.menu .item{color: #FFF}div.ccm-page .ui.tabular.menu .item.active{color: #000}div.ccm-page .ui.stackable.two.column.grid.container .column img{width: 100%;height: auto}div.ccm-page .ui.stackable.two.column.grid.container .column .p50 img{width: 50%}div.ccm-page .ui.stackable.two.column.grid.container .column .p33 img{width: 33%}